Located in Calvert, 35 miles north of Mobile, Alabama, our state-of-the-art steel processing facility has the capacity to process 5.3 million tons of high-value steel grades in the North America market.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in Engineering.
  • Minimum 5 years of experience in Cold Rolling Mill field.
  • Background in major steel mill processes and products with in-depth knowledge of pickling and rolling processes and technology.
  • Knowledge of steel strip properties and applications.
  • Understanding steel sheet rolling and pickling process, process control, properties and metallurgy of steels.
  • Demonstrates understanding of control systems, instrumentation, and process models.

Nice To Haves

  • Advanced Technical knowledge of cold rolling and pickling process and flat carbon products.
  • Strong Teamwork and a hands-on working approach.
  • Advanced skills in data analysis, Statistics (design of experiments, data analysis and model formulation).

Responsibilities

  • Developing and maintaining an effective technical team responsible for CRM process technology and development.
  • Leads major improvement projects, improving process and product capabilities, throughput, cost (yield), energy and environmental performance.
  • Providing technical support for all CRM units, reporting process performance to Senior management, and managing/improving statistical systems that define product/process capabilities.
  • Developing/improving inspection and testing methods, driving functionality and performance of process models/control systems.
